The Goethe-Zertifikat A1: Start Deutsch 1 Exam

The Goethe-Zertifikat A1: Start Deutsch 1 test is the first formal step in learning a language for adults. It is an articulation of the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R) and is administered by the Goethe-Institut.

The test consists of sections on reading, listening and speaking. The speaking portion is completed in groups.

What is the A1 Exam?

The Goethe-Zertifikat A1 Start Deutsch 1 is a German Language Exam for Adults. It is a basic level test that demonstrates your ability to communicate in simple conversations and to comprehend the everyday context. It is the first level of the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R) and is an excellent way to demonstrate that you have learned basic proficiency in a language.

The test is divided into four parts comprising writing, listening and speaking. You will be asked to read short messages, signs and labels in the reading section. You will be asked to fill out forms and write an email or a short letter on everyday topics. In the speaking portion, you will be asked to describe yourself, describe the place you work and live and ask a few basic questions. In the listening portion, you will be asked to listen to audio recordings of everyday conversations, announcements, telephone messages and then answer questions based on the audio you hear.

What is the structure of the A1 exam?

The A1 test is a standard test of language that tests the fundamental skills required for communicating in German. The test is designed to aid non-natives prove their proficiency in German. This is an excellent way to begin your journey to proficiency, and it is typically required when applying for visas. This test is an important step to achieving your goals regardless of whether you wish to study or travel in Germany.

The Goethe-Zertifikat A1 exam includes sections on listening, reading, and speaking. The test is conducted in the same way across the globe. You will be asked to read brief notes, classified advertisements, descriptions of people and basic newspaper text in the reading section. Then, you will complete tasks based upon these. You will also hear short everyday conversations, personal telephone messages and announcements from the public over a loudspeaker. Complete tasks based on the information you receive.

In the writing section, you will write a letter, reply to an email or similar. You will also be required to write short passages about a topic of everyday interest and complete tasks inspired by these.
